The Savage Locathah: A Tribal Profile
The feral Locathah are a water-dwelling race inhabiting the murky depths of the subterranean waterways. They are typically short humanoids, distinguished by their slimy skin, paddle-shaped hands and feet, and glowing eyes adapted to the perpetual gloom. Known for their brutal nature and erratic behavior, Locathah tribes live in remote communities, rarely contacting with the surface world. Their culture is rigidly structured, revolving around a powerful shaman who understands the will of the deep spirits. Life for the Locathah is a constant struggle against the hostile creatures that share their subterranean realm.
- Hunting: Employing basic tools and group tactics, they hunt giant fish.
- Beliefs: Locathah honor beings of the deep ocean.
- Appearance: Their coloration ranges from slate gray to pale blue.
Frequently considered savage, the Locathah represent a genuinely strange culture, posing a significant threat to anyone who wanders into their territory.
Coping with the Darkness: Deepspawn Raider Culture
The Locathah, a powerful race dwelling in the shadowy regions of the ocean, exhibit a distinct combatant culture shaped by constant struggle. Life is a relentless fight against monstrous beasts and the crushing force of the deep, fostering a harsh spirit. Their societal structure revolves around tribes, led by the strongest warrior, who earns their status through deeds of strength. Beliefs prioritize might, resourcefulness, and a deep loyalty to one’s kin. Offspring are prepared from a young age in the arts of combat, utilizing spears and their natural swimming skills.
- Rituals often involve challenging one's endurance.
- Oral tradition passes down the tales of their forebears, emphasizing determination.
- Adornment on their bodies – often through scarification or dye – denote rank and memorable occasions.

Ancient Lore: The Origins of the Locathah
Legend tellsrelates of the Locathah, a race dwellingfound within the dark waters of the Abyssal Plain. Some suppose they are an early offshoot of the sea-faring people, cast from the surface world ages previously due to a catastrophic transgression. Others suggest a far greater origin, positing they are progeny of a sea god, imbued with strange abilities and tasked with the secrets of the abyss. The true genesis of the Locathah remains shrouded in obscurity, fueling countless tales and adding to their allure.
